Recipe - Kalua Pork (Cooked Inside)
Categories: Meat, Kalua Pork (Cooked Inside)
4 pound Pork butt roast
2 cup Water
2 tablespoon Liquid smoke flavoring
4 tablespoon Hawaiian salt

Score Pork. Combine liquid smoke, water and salt and pour over pork and
marinate 23 hours. (Better overnight.) Put pork and marinade into a
roasting pan or large casserole. Cover and roast at 400 degrees for 3
hours. (Good recipe for chilly day since it heats up the house.) Remove
from pan and shred pork. You can also do it in the microwave. Cook on high
for 30 minutes, turn and continue to cook for an additional 80 minutes at
70% power. Turn pork every 20 minutes. Let stand 15 minutes. Remove pork
and shred. You can add a very small amount of liquid to shredded meat, if
desired.
